It is FireFox that has hidden settings (about:config) adjusted for privacy. It refers to using a js file such as betterfox or arkenfox, or a pre-hardened fork of FireFox (Librewolf on desktop or Mull Browser on Android). You can improve your privacy by using a hardened FireFox, however you may also encounter more issues with website compatibility. It is a trade-off, and is usually only recommended for advanced users.
